Locking Wheel Nut Keys

The locking wheel nuts can be an easy but effective deterrent for criminals who want to take the wheels off your car. They are like standard lug nuts but have a cut out in the centre to ensure that they can only be removed using the appropriate key. They are also designed to be much more difficult to remove than lug nuts that are standard, which is an additional deterrent for thieves.

The locking key nut keys come with a hexagonal edge on one side and a cylindrical end on the other. They are unique to the set that came with your car therefore you must verify first. They are often kept to keep safe in the boot (if your car has an extra wheel) or in the glove box along with your car ownership manual.


Other places to look are the door card pockets or the centre console storage compartments - they may have ended up there after your vehicle was changed hands a several times. Remote Keys

A remote key (also called a smart key) is designed to offer you the convenience of locking and unlocking your vehicle without having to insert the keyblade in the lock. It's powered by a battery, and comes with buttons you can press to start the ignition. The chip inside the head of the remote key communicates with your car to begin it.

The most common reason that causes the remote control on your C1's to cease functioning is a dead battery which can be replaced in just a few minutes. Make sure that the buttons are all pressed and that the metal clips are firmly placed in order to confirm that the circuit is in place.

Water damage is another common cause of a Citroen C1 remote key not working. Even a brief bath in a sink with soapy water or a plunge into an ocean or pool will result in serious damage to your key fob electronics. You must remove the fob's key and dry it off with a paper towel before installing it.

A malfunctioning receiver module could also prevent your Citroen C1 remote key from working. You can try restarting your system by disconnecting the battery at 12 volts for a short period of time. This will drain all residual energy and restart the on-board computer.
